  • per·func·to·ry   per-fuhngk-tuh-ree Show IPA

    adjective

    Perfunctory,

    1.

    performed merely as a routine duty; hasty and superficial: perfunctory courtesy.

    2.

    lacking interest, care, or enthusiasm; indifferent or apathetic: In his lectures he reveals himself to be merely a perfunctory speaker.
